This search is for records of all death cases reported to, examined by or certified by the Bexar County Medical Examiner’s Office during the selected time frame (within the last 30 days). It is not a comprehensive listing of all deaths in Bexar County. WebMar 16, 2024 · The largest collection of publicly available New York City birth, marriage, and death records is now online and free to access! The New York City Municipal Archives has been working to digitize the millions of birth, marriage, and death records it holds since 2013. WebApr 5, 2024 · Contact the vital records office of the state where the death occurred to learn: How to order a certified copy of a death certificate online, by mail, or in-person. You will need to know the date and place of death. The state may also ask for other details about the person, how you are related to them, or why you want the certificate. WebThe cost of a death certificate at the Florida Bureau of Vital Statistics is as follows: $5 - Search fee for one calendar year and one certified copy. $4 - For each additional certified copy. $2 - Search fee for each calendar year when the precise year is unknown. The maximum fee $50.00. Next … WebAug 19, 2024 · Though you can’t access the Death Master File, you can access the Social Security Death Index through a genealogy website. Most genealogy websites require you to purchase a paid subscription or membership to search the Social Security Death Index. However, some offer free trials or limited information.
